                                  Motorpsycho – “Maiden Voyage”

                                  Motorpsycho debuted like so many other bands from the environment at the UFFA house in Trondheim, with a demo cassette published by Knallsyndikatet. This demo came in a numbered and stamped edition of 100 ex in 1990, and has today become a collector's item that is so in demand that it has even been booted.

                                  The Counts Along Secret Society is proud to be able to provide the first official re-release of this classic demo: the humble beginnings of a long career that grew somewhat more impressive in the long run, and still continues today.
